Structures of monomeric and oligomeric forms of the Toxoplasma gondii perforin-like protein 1
Copyright © 2018 The Authors, some rights reserved. Toxoplasma and Plasmodium are the parasitic agents of toxoplasmosis and malaria, respectively, and use perforinlike proteins (PLPs) to invade host organisms and complete their life cycles.
